Why convert MRW to CAF?
Convert to CAF when working inside Apple audio pipelines, especially for long recordings, app assets, sound libraries, or technical workflows that benefit from Core Audio compatibility.
It is a good target when AIFF or WAV limitations are inconvenient but Apple tooling is the primary consumer.
For general exchange, WAV, AIFF, or M4A are usually easier handoff formats.
